AP Human Geography. Centripetal and Centrifugal Forces Free Response. 3a. The concept “centripetal force” is defined as a force or attitude that tends to unify people and enhance support for a state. They provide stability, strengthen the state, help bind people together, and create unity.

Centrifugal forces refer to forces that tend to pull a system or entity apart, while centripetal forces refer to forces that tend to hold a system or entity together. Physical geography can cause isolation due to natural features. The Kashmir area between India and Pakistan can feel isolated because it is separated by the Himalayan and Pir Panjal mountains.
